This is off the topic of swimming, but the historical record should be accurate. The Class of 1984 would have matriculated in summer/autumn of 1980. Ronald Reagan was elected President in November 1980.

International hostilities were bubbling in the 1979/1980 period when people would have applied and been admitted to the Air Force Academy. The following is an oversimplified account of some of the events of that time.

In February 1979 the Shah of Iran was overthrown. The U.S. embassy in Tehran was seized and hostages held for a brief period. In November 1979 the U.S. embassy was invaded, and American hostages were seized, this time for good. The heroic but disastrous attempt to rescue the hostages, Operation Eagle Claw, occurred on April 24, 1980.

Soviet deployment to Afghanistan began in December 1979. This followed the overthrow of the previous Afghan government by Soviet-friendly communists in early 1978. In July 1979, Pres. Carter authorized aid to be given secretly to opponents of the pro-Soviet regime with the hope that the Soviets would be sucked into the morass.
